Alexis Nicholson+FollowFound the Real Sweet Spot for Sleep & StepsTurns out, there’s a magic combo for sleep and exercise: people who sleep 6-7 hours a night actually walk more the next day than those who sleep longer! Scientists tracked 70,000+ people and found both too little and too much sleep means fewer steps. Only about 13% of us hit the 'ideal' sleep and step goals. So maybe it’s time to rethink those one-size-fits-all health rules? #Fitness #SleepScience #StepGoals00Share

margaret39+FollowShaved 8 Minutes Off My 5K—This Treadmill Hack WorksNever thought a treadmill workout could make me THAT much faster, but the Norwegian 4x4 HIIT routine is wild. Four rounds of 4-min hard runs with 3-min easy jogs in between, once a week, and my 5K time dropped by almost 8 minutes! It’s sweaty but doable, and you don’t have to be a pro. Bonus: you can do it with cycling or swimming too. Ready to level up your cardio? #Fitness #RunningTips #TreadmillWorkout10Share

Jennifer Price+FollowFasting: The Brain Hack No One Saw ComingIntermittent fasting isn’t just about dropping pounds anymore—early research says it might actually rewire your brain! Scientists are seeing signs that skipping meals can spark changes in brain activity, boost mood, and even help protect against diseases like Alzheimer’s. The catch? The data’s still new, and it’s not for everyone (especially if you have health conditions). But if you’ve ever wondered if fasting could make you sharper, the science is starting to say maybe! #Fitness #IntermittentFasting #BrainHealth51Share
